WebGST collected from customers (Output Tax) GST paid on purchases and expenses for the business (Input tax) Net GST* If net GST is positive (i.e. Output tax > Input tax), this will be the amount that is payable by you to IRAS. If net GST is negative (i.e. Output tax < Input tax), this will be the amount that is to be refunded to you by IRAS. lists of things quizWebMar 2, 2024 · The system only uses the standard template. Your customer needs to keep this tax invoice as a supporting document to claim input tax on its standard-rated purchases. In general, a tax invoice must be issued within 30 days from the time of supply. list soft deleted mailboxes exchange 2016
